They do not add brackets / anchors but they do use a straight-across aligned as opposed to a more trimmed "scalloped" aligner. The straight across gets a bit more turning force because it goes higher up and covers a bit of your gums. I'm no expert so I don't know if that's the whole story. They definitely filter out people with more complicated alignment issues so that could play a role as well.
